Need a little help fellas - my '79 is blowing the gas gauge fuse over and over again. It blows within seconds of me turning the ignition key.

This fuse also takes out the seat belt chime and low oil pressure light, FWIW. I am able to drive with no problems, and no other systems seem to be affected.

A pinched wire somewhere. Remove the seat belt chime, see if it no longer blows the fuse. This is a case where you have to inspect ALL wiring related to these 3 circuits. Logic says to disconnect each item one at a time till the fuse no longer blows. So, remove the chime module, try fuse. If it blows, disconnect wiring to fuel tank sender, try fuse. then if still blows inspect printed circuit board for oil pressure light.
